Beschreibung
Zusammenfassung:Conference calls in a GSM network are provided by processing incoming speech from participants 10-13 in a conference bridge 18 including a voice activated detector 19, which can distinguish silent periods. Speech components are encoded by a multi-channel variable bitrate coder and sent through a multi-channel link 20 to a receiving terminal 14. Non-speech components are coded as a silence signal to reduce transmission bandwidth requirements. At receiving terminal 14 voice components are passed to a spatial processor, which distinguishes between source participants by the channel containing the coded speech. Each participant's voice is located at a spatially separated location, to aid identification. The spatial processor may alternatively be located within the network, which sends stereo signals to the terminal 14.
